Re: Overheating – All You Need To Know by 9icetoo(m): 10:29am On Sep 20, 2014
piagetskinner: nice one @OP. I have two questions that have been bothering me. My 2004 toyota camry always makes squeaky noise when I turn the steering,the car vibrates seriously when I put on the A/C,and when I put it off the vibration reduces by 70%...and just yesterday one of the fans stopped working and the temp rose to half on the temp scale....I drove it around town 4 an hour or so,and when I got home it took more than 2hours before it finally cooled...what solutions can u proffer?thanks
Your cars temp gauge should be at the half way mark maximum ten minutes after you start your car. If it is below that, ur engine is running cold and if it is way above that, then u r slightly in the over heat zone. Half way mark is normal for ur car and any other car i know of. Don't let the mechanics tell you otherwise. The squeaky noise you hear when u turn ur steering is your serpentine belt tensioner not doing its job. It is supposed to adjust to load put on the serpentine belt. It is essentially a shock absorber. Change it. The vibration u hear or feel when u put on your ac is as a result of weak engine mounts. Ask your mechanic to check ur engine mounts and replace the bad ones. However, it would be a good idea to do a tune up which often solves a lot of ur problems with regards to the vibration. Clean ur intake manifold, change ur spark plugs to the original recommended by ur car manufacturer. Use an electrical contact cleaner to clean ur air flow meter. you can also do the italian tune up to clear the carbon from ur pistons. U can google how to do that one. after these, ur vehicle should be back in tip top shape.

Re: Overheating – All You Need To Know by Nobody: 8:00pm On Sep 20, 2014
erico2k2:
More so that might as well have increased the volume of coolant in the Engine of which the original pump and thermostat where not designed to cope with

That has no effect on it actually.

We've tested this before.

In fact on Austin Minis one of the trick is to install an auxiliary radiator in line to help with cooling on hot days. So you basically have two or three radiators.

The thermostat only open and closes base don the temperature that it senses. The water pump, except on electric ones, just pumps water continuously through the engine and heating elements such as the radiator (s) or heater core.

On the Toyota MR2, the same engine i sin the Toyota Camry and they use the same water pumps. The radiator in the Camry is maybe 1 foot from the pump while the setup in the MR2 places the engine in the back and the radiator all the way in the front maybe 10 feet?
